The British Stainless Steel Association [BSSA], is holding a half-day workshop entitled 'An Introduction to Stainless Steel' on Tuesday 28th November at the National Metalforming Centre [NMC] in West Bromwich This starter workshop to be held between 10.30 - 3 pm is a comprehensive introduction to the uses and applications of stainless steel, specifically designed for both newcomers to the industry and personnel seeking a refresher on the basics

Topics that will highlight why stainless steel is such a cost-effective yet aesthetic material include grades, finishes, corrosion and mechanical properties.

The workshop will also provide an insight into the BSSA's Stainless Steel Specialist Course of self-study modules allowing participants to learn at a pace which they can vary to the demands of their jobs and achieve upon successful completion, an accredited certification from the BSSA.

The cost of the workshop is £125 + VAT for BSSA members and £175 + VAT for non-members.

Refreshments and lunch are included.

In-house workshops are also available, which can be designed to meet individual company needs and are particularly useful where there are several candidates.
